Exchange-Traded Funds, Equity Futures Mixed Pre-Bell Monday as Investors Assess Fed's Interest Rate Outlook
Dec 23, 2024 5:26 AM

08:04 AM EST, 12/23/2024 (MT Newswires) -- The broad market exchange-traded fund S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ust ( SPY ) slipped 0.02% and the actively traded Invesco QQQ Trust (QQQ) advanced 0.4% in Monday's premarket activity, as investors assessed next year's interest rate outlook after the Fed signaled prolonged higher rates.

US stock futures were also mixed, with S&P 500 Index futures up 0.1%, Dow Jones Industrial Average futures slipping 0.2%, and Nasdaq futures gaining 0.4% before the start of regular trading.

November's Chicago Fed National Activity Index will be released at 8:30 am ET, followed by the Conference Board's consumer confidence report for December at 10 am ET.

In premarket action, bitcoin was up by 0.6%, while the cryptocurrency fund ProShares Bitcoin Strategy ETF (BITO) was down by 4.8%.

Power Play:

Consumer

The Consumer Staples Select Sector SPDR Fund ( XLP ) was down 0.1%, while the Vanguard Consumer Staples Fund (VDC) was 1.2% lower. The iShares US Consumer Staples ETF ( IYK ) was inactive, and the Consumer Discretionary Select Sector SPDR Fund ( XLY ) gained 0.4%. The VanEck Retail ETF ( RTH ) and the SPDR S&P Retail ETF ( XRT ) were inactive.

Honda Motor ( HMC ) shares were up more than 14% pre-bell after the company and Nissan Motor said they had signed a memorandum of understanding to discuss the possibility of a merger and create a joint holding company.

Winners and Losers:

Technology

Technology Select Sector SPDR Fund (XLK) gained 0.5%, and the iShares US Technology ETF ( IYW ) was 0.3% higher, while the iShares Expanded Tech Sector ETF ( IGM ) was up 0.5%. Among semiconductor ETFs, SPDR S&P Semiconductor ETF ( XSD ) was inactive, while the iShares Semiconductor ETF (SOXX) rose by 1.2%.

Xerox Holdings ( XRX ) shares were up 5.6% in recent Monday premarket activity after the company said that it has agreed to acquire Lexmark International from Ninestar, PAG Asia Capital, and Shanghai Shouda Investment Center for $1.5 billion, including assumed liabilities.

Health Care

The Health Care Select Sector SPDR Fund ( XLV ) advanced 0.2%. The Vanguard Health Care Index Fund ( VHT ) was down 0.7% while the iShares US Healthcare ETF ( IYH ) was inactive. The iShares Biotechnology ETF (IBB) was inactive.

Zomedica ( ZOM ) stock was down 3.4% premarket after the company said that it has launched two new canine assays for its Truforma in-clinic biosensor testing platform.

Financial

Financial Select Sector SPDR Fund (XLF) retreated 0.1%. Direxion Daily Financial Bull 3X Shares ( FAS ) was down 0.6%, while its bearish counterpart Direxion Daily Financial Bear 3X Shares ( FAZ ) was 0.5% higher.

National Health Investors ( NHI ) shares were down 1.1% pre-bell Monday after Truist lowered the company's price target to $72 from $78.

Industrial

Industrial Select Sector SPDR Fund ( XLI ) advanced 0.1%, the Vanguard Industrials Index Fund ( VIS ) gained 0.2%, while the iShares US Industrials ETF ( IYJ ) was inactive.

Laser Photonics ( LASE ) stock was up nearly 1% before the opening bell after the company said it received an order for its handheld continuous wave fiber laser machine for surface preparation from the Cooper Nuclear Station in Nebraska, US.

Energy

The iShares US Energy ETF ( IYE ) gained 0.2%, while the Energy Select Sector SPDR Fund ( XLE ) was up by 0.1%.

Vermilion Energy ( VET ) stock was up nearly 1% before Monday's opening bell after the company said it has agreed to acquire Westbrick Energy for $1.08 billion in cash.

Commodities

Front-month US West Texas Intermediate crude oil retreated 0.3% to $69.28 per barrel on the New York Mercantile Exchange. Natural gas gained 2.1% to $3.83 per 1 million British Thermal Units. United States Oil Fund ( USO ) declined by 0.6%, while the United States Natural Gas Fund ( UNG ) rose by 0.8%.

Gold futures for February were down 0.6% to $2,629 an ounce on the Comex, while silver futures gained 0.7% at $30.16 an ounce. SPDR Gold Shares ( GLD ) retreated 0.4%, while the iShares Silver Trust ( SLV ) was 0.2% higher.
